# Build Provenance: FieldPulse Gateway

Every FieldPulse telemetry gateway image is built on the Orsten pipeline from a signed tag, and no manual uploads are permitted. Before deploying to a combine fleet, verify the artifact against the provenance ledger maintained by the Kellvane team. The canonical trace token for the current production image appears directly below.

session token of bajog-tadup = htk3_ffc

## Onboarding: EXIF Scrubbing Pipeline

All user-uploaded images at Lanternfox pass through the scrub-worker before reaching storage. The worker strips GPS coordinates, device serials, and timestamps from EXIF blocks, then records a checksum of the sanitized file for later verification. If a scrub fails, the image is quarantined and an entry is written to the audit table. New engineers should verify their local worker can reach the quarantine database. Use the connection string below:

warehouse DSN: postgresql://kasax_svc:qKMoO2AkuKwZ23@db-b256.kelviio.example:5432/framir

// DEFAULT_RESIZE_BATCH_SIZE controls how many images the Fernclip CLI
// processes per worker pass when no --batch flag is supplied. Plugin
// authors should treat this as an upper bound, not a guarantee: the
// scheduler may shrink batches under memory pressure, and hooks fired
// per batch must tolerate partial sets. Changing this value changes the
// ordering of post-resize hooks, so bump your plugin's compatibility
// declaration if you depend on it. Compatibility is checked against the
// host build token recorded below.

session token of kageg-tahop = htk14_af3c1ccccb7dcf

Welcome to the Scalewright review rotation. The queue-depth autoscaler polls the Brineline broker every fifteen seconds and computes a rolling median of pending messages per partition. When reviewing changes, verify that scale-down decisions respect the cooldown window defined in scaling.toml, since premature shrinking has caused consumer churn before. Local integration tests require authenticating against the internal metrics service. Use the key below for that purpose.

service key, fawip-bajef: kto11_Qt5wZK9vdNC